Creighton University School of Medicine joined CHI Health to celebrate the grand opening of the new CHI Health Orthopedic Center at Lakeside in Omaha, NE. The new center brings together advanced technology, research, rehabilitation and physician training in one location, creating new opportunities to improve patient care across the region. It will also serve as the clinical home of Creighton's Orthopaedic Surgery Residency Program, where future orthopedic surgeons will train alongside experienced physicians using state-of-the-art equipment and simulation spaces. This investment reflects a shared with commitment to innovate, educate and expand access to exceptional orthopedic care for the communities we serve.
